Water Saving summer 2021-2022

WATER SAVING: CANNON ROCKS/BOKNESSTRAND Below is the directive from the Ndlambe Municipality regarding efforts to save water. The water saving campaign is applicable to water obtained from the municipal main water supply system in Cannon Rocks and Boknesstrand only, and therefore not applicable to water obtained from private boreholes and or rainwater tanks.
